
Smoked Cajun Spatchcock Turkey
Write a Review Read Reviews
- Yields: 8–10 Servings
- Cook time: 3 h
- Prep time: 20 minutes
Ingredients
- 14 pounds turkey
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 3 tablespoons Rob's Screamin' Pig Rub
- 2 sticks butter, melted
- 3 tablespoons Cajun seasoning
- 2 tablespoons garlic powder
Instructions
- Pre-heat recteq grill or wood pellet grill to 350°F.
- Inject turkey with Cajun butter.
- Rub skin with olive oil.
- Liberally apply seasoning.
- Smoke turkey at 350°F until the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
